The livewell pump draws water through the strainer mounted on the inboard side of the starboard sponson. A seacock
is installed between the pickup and the pump to allow you to seal the system between use, or in the event of a
plumbing failure.
To operate the livewell, first verify that the seacock is open and install the livewell drain plug. When you have
completed these steps, engage the livewell pump using the console switch pod. The livewell light is also controlled
by the switch. Water will fill the tank until it is level with the overflow drain, which will evacuate water through a
hullside drain. When you have finished using the livewell, remove the drain plug to allow the water to drain
overboard.
NOTICE
While underway, leaving your livewell seacock open could result in inadvertently filling your livewell.
To prevent this, close the seacock when the pump is not in operation.
NOTICE
Operating the engines in reverse can cause excessive ventilation near the livewell intake, causing the
pump to airlock. To prevent this, turn the pumps “OFF” prior to any continuous or high speed reverse
operation. If your pump does becomes air locked, turn the pump “OFF” for 15 to 30 seconds to correct
the problem.
10.1.7 Raw Water System
The raw water pump is located in the starboard aft rigging compartment and can be accessed through the hatch
located on the vertical wall beneath the fold down aft seat. The pump and wiring are mounted on the rigging wall at
the back of the compartment. The raw water pump is connected to the dual purpose livewell pump which brings in
water through a strainer located on the inboard side of the starboard sponson. The livewell/raw water seacock must be
open for the system to work, however, the livewell pump does not have to be “ON”. Similar to the freshwater pump,
the raw water system is controlled by a pressure switch set at 45 psi. The pump will cycle on and off as needed to
maintain this pressure. Most owners leave the pump “on” throughout the day, and use the system when necessary. On
the 255DC, the raw water pump feeds the raw water outlet located outboard of the starboad rear fold down aft seat.
To view the layout of the raw water system see the drawing in section 10.3.10.
10.1.8 Marine Head
The 255DC comes equipped with a marine head in the port changing area. The control panel for the head is located
on the head instrument panel located on the vertical wall adjacent to the toilet. Power is supplied to this panel through
a 25 amp breaker located in the console on the accessory fuse block. The panel controls the water level in the bowl
and the discharge of waste from the head.
Water is supplied to the system from the freshwater tanklocated under the helm. To operate the toilet the freshwater
system must be pressurized. A solenoid, installed near the head inlet, prevents water from filling the bowl prior to
each use. The macerator pump, located at the rear of the toilet, removes waste from the bowl and pumps it into the 10
gallon holding tank.
